Output 9ca7341cc4a06bec181a622d4db32f0effeb78894f74ea4ec00e94b65edadb05:1

value
709303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13f23c4bfc3eb31e5daf48241d0167f9aacb6ca1 OP_EQUAL
address
33WUx1Swn8imUMjJiyRmaHsKFhcAMBQbGy
transaction
9ca7341cc4a06bec181a622d4db32f0effeb78894f74ea4ec00e94b65edadb05
confirmations
342759
spent
true